The problem associated with "cupboard hidden" bins is that they have always been small, because the cupboard that the bin is fitted to is either not solely dedicated to the bin or the lid open-closure mechanism has relied on a flip-top opening mechanism. To produce a larger bin, and solve this problem, there is provided a bin comprising a lid and a number of containers, their arrangement being such that they are able to move relative to each other within substantially the same plane and wherein a running clearance tolerance exists between the lid and the or each container that is such that when the bin moves from an open to a closed position the lid and a mouth of the of the or each container merge into substantially sealing contact with each other.
